Clearing blocked drains
Blocked kitchen area sinks are one of the most usual drain problems homeowners encounter. As well as what's more, it's a unpleasant and also extremely uncomfortable view. Envision going to the sink to do your recipes as well as figuring out that the drain is obstructed as well as water can not move down easily.
The majority of blocked water drainages are caused by food particles, oil, fat, and also soap particles. They clog the sink and also make it hard for water to drop the drainpipe promptly. While it is appealing to put a call through to the plumbing technicians, there are a couple of DIY hacks you can try first before making that call.
In this short article, we will be checking out five basic steps you might take to free your kitchen sink from clogs and also conserve you from the pain as well as humiliation of handling a blocked kitchen sink.

1. Usage Boiling Water


When faced with a clogged up sink, the first thing you ought to attempt is to pour boiling thin down the drainpipe. That is about one of the most straightforward treatment to clogged up sinks as well as water drainages. Boiling water helps reduce the effects of the fragments and also debris triggering the clog, especially if it's soap, oil, or oil bits, as well as in a lot of cases, it can flush it all down, as well as your sink will be back to normal.
Because hot water might thaw the lines and also cause more damages, do not attempt this approach if you have plastic pipelines (PVC). You might desire to stick to using a plunger to get debris out if you utilize plastic pipelines.
Using this technique, switch on the faucet to see how water flows after putting warm water away. If the blockage persists, try the procedure once more. Nevertheless, the blockage could be more consistent sometimes and also need greater than just boiling water.

2. Possibly it's the Garbage Disposal


Oftentimes, the clog might be because of an obstruction in the disposal. Switching on the disposal ought to clear the blockage, yet it can imply that food particles or other compounds are stuck in between the blades if that is unsuccessful. You can try to unclog it by transforming the blades by hand in a proposal to free it. Please see to it not to stick your hands in the blades; they're sharp. Use pliers rather.
If this does not work, you can check out the adhering to alternative to unclog your kitchen area sink.

3. Attempt a Plunger


If the issue is not from the garbage disposal, you can try using a plunger. Plungers are typical residence tools for this occasion, and also they can be available in useful if you use them correctly. A flat-bottomed plunger is most suitable for this, but you can make do with what you have is a toilet bettor.
Adhere to the following straightforward actions to make use of the bettor successfully:
Secure the drain with a rag and also load the sink with some hot water
Place the plunger in position over the drainpipe and start diving
Check to see if the water runs easily after a couple of plunges
Repeat the procedure until the drain is totally free

4. Baking Soda as well as Vinegar


Instead of utilizing any type of form of chemicals or bleach, this technique is more secure and not hazardous to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and vinegar are daily house things used for several various other things, and also they can do the trick to your cooking area sink.
Firstly, remove any water that is left in the sink with a cup.
Then pour a great amount of baking soda down the tubes.
Pour in one mug of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ening as well as enable it to opt for some minutes.
Pour hot water down the drain to melt away various other persistent deposit and particles.
Following this simple approach can work, and you can have your kitchen area sink back. Repeat the procedure as much as you deem essential to rid the sink of this debris totally.

5. Make use of a Hanger


This trick is efficient as well as resourceful, especially if you know and also possibly see what's causing the obstruction. Sometimes, the obstruction could be triggered by hair, precious jewelry, or significant pieces of food bits. Utilizing a cable fabric hanger or a plumber's serpent if you have one can do the technique. All you need do is align the wall mount to drop the drain while you very carefully pick out the bits triggering the clog.
Run hot water down the drain after this to see how successful you were.

HOW TO UNCLOG A SINK DRAIN: 5 HELPFUL TIPS FROM PLUMBING EXPERTS


Using soap and hot water


If the clog is caused by grease accumulations, pouring dish soap down the drain, followed by a large pot of boiling water, may dissolve the clog. Use about to 1 cup of soap and about a gallon of water, being careful not to burn yourself.


Using a solution of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water


For more stubborn clogs, a combination of baking soda, vinegar, and hot water may do the trick. Because vinegar is an acid and baking soda is a base, mixing the two will cause a chemical reaction that will create pressure and possibly dislodge the clog. For this method, pour cup of baking soda down the drain, followed by cup of white vinegar and, then, plenty of hot water.



If none of these methods work, it may be time to call a plumbing expert for help. Experienced plumbers can provide professional drain cleaning services, removing any stubborn clogs without damaging your plumbing system. They can also determine if your drain problems are being caused by something more problematic, like damaged pipes or sewer line clogs.


Plunging


A standard plunger can unclog many sink drains with minimal effort. When plunging sinks, make sure that any overflow openings in the sink are covered with wet rags. Then, cover the sink drain with the plunger, and plunge 5 to 10 times to try to break up the clog. If you have a double sink, make sure that the second drain is covered. And, if your first attempt at plunging fails, run some hot water down the drain, then try again.


Snaking


If you have a pipe snake, a coat hanger, or a stiff wire, you can try to physically dislodge the clog by feeding the wire down the drain. When using this method, do not force the wire too hard. Also, make sure that you can easily pull it back up whenever necessary.
